NIGHTSCAPES was a solo exhibition by Swiss-Italian photographer, Ugo Ricciardi, featuring photography and video works. These images were captured in Ireland and worldwide as part of his ongoing NIGHTSCAPES project, which explores his fascination with symbolic locations and architecture.

NIGHTSCAPES presented selected photographic, large-scale prints, and video works from Ricciardi’s ongoing Nightscapes project, which focuses on the human connection with nature and its ancestral past. The project takes the artist around the world, capturing breath-taking nightscapes of landmarks and ancient sites illuminated by the moon and his digital lighting interventions.

Ugo Ricciardi

Ugo Ricciardi

Ugo Ricciardi, born in 1975, is a Swiss-Italian photographer.
